Analysis

The most recent figure for timely indicators of entrepreneurship by enterprise characteristics in Belgium is 106,966 Enterprises, measured in 2024.

That represents a change of down 0.6% on the previous year and up 27.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, timely indicators of entrepreneurship by enterprise characteristics in Belgium peaked at 120,391 Enterprises in 2022 and was at its lowest, 59,432 Enterprises, in 2009.

That places Belgium 11th out of 23 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 18 years of available data.

Timely indicators of entrepreneurship by enterprise characteristics in Belgium, year by year

Annual values for Timely indicators of entrepreneurship by enterprise characteristics — Business entries in Belgium, 2007 to 2024.
Year Enterprises Change
2007 65,138 Enterprises
2008 62,995 Enterprises -3.3%
2009 59,432 Enterprises -5.7%
2010 65,195 Enterprises +9.7%
2011 67,155 Enterprises +3.0%
2012 66,255 Enterprises -1.3%
2013 64,610 Enterprises -2.5%
2014 84,253 Enterprises +30.4%
2015 73,472 Enterprises -12.8%
2016 83,187 Enterprises +13.2%
2017 85,445 Enterprises +2.7%
2018 89,012 Enterprises +4.2%
2019 96,523 Enterprises +8.4%
2020 97,078 Enterprises +0.6%
2021 107,834 Enterprises +11.1%
2022 120,391 Enterprises +11.6%
2023 107,632 Enterprises -10.6%
2024 106,966 Enterprises -0.6%

Timely Indicators of Entrepreneurship have become integral part of business statistics offering of most OECD member countries and beyond. It supplements more complete annual datasets (e.g. Business Demography, Structural Business Statistics by Size class) with more timely monthly or quarterly information on a limited number of indicators.Data are broken down whenever available byeconomic activity according to International Standard Industrial Classification, Revision 4 (ISIC Rev.4): ISIC Rev. 4 at the level of sections (letters) and higher aggregates, most often covering the total economy, geographic area at country and TL2 level of the OECD Territorial grids, legal form into three main groups: Limited liability (LL), Partnership (PA) and Sole proprietorship (SP). With very few exceptions, series are not seasonally or calendar adjusted, so care should be taken in interpreting sub-annual changes. Timely Indicators of Entrepreneurship provide valuable information to policy makers and researchers on most recent trends in business dynamics.Related datasets:Employer Business Demography Statistics,Business Demography Statistics,Structural Business Statistics by Size Class.
